Gulf War Casualties

I was concerned that the 50 Q&A'a posted below had inaccurate facts in several places. The one easiest to check is on casualties.

The United States suffered 148 killed in action, 458 wounded, 121 killed in nonhostile actions and 11 female combat deaths

That is more than 0.

In June 1991 the U.S. estimated that more than 100,000 Iraqi soldiers died, 300,000 were wounded, 150,000 deserted, and 60,000 were taken prisoner. Many human rights groups claimed a much higher numbers of Iraqi killed in action.
